FreeDiff v1.1.2

Freeware
Vista / WinXP
FreeDiff can analyze the changes between two revisions of a file.

FreeDiff can be used to locate the differences in program source code files, HTML documents, and any other ASCII-based text files. A color-coded side-by-side display of the comparison results makes it easy to understand the differences between the two files at a glance.

Key Features:
  • Free of charge!
  • Search for text within the files
  • Differences are shown with color highlighting
  • Easy navigation from one difference to another
  • Compares ASCII text files in a side-by-side format

  • Differences down to the character-level are shown
  • Bookmarks can be added to the comparison results
  • Allows drag and drop of files onto FreeDiff for comparison
  • Auto-completes file specifications as they are typed in
  • Ignore Space and Ignore Case comparison options supported
  • Files can be printed with the differences pointed out
